Comprehending Sash Windows
Before diving into replacement services, it's necessary to understand what sash windows are. Defined by their sliding sashes, they include 2 movable panels that can be opened vertically. Conventional sash windows are typically made from wood, although modern variations might use other products such as uPVC or aluminum.

Why Replacement is Necessary
Over time, even the most meticulously preserved sash windows can reveal signs of wear and tear. Factors such as weathering, rot, and bad insulation are major contributors to the need for replacement. The presence of damaged sash windows can:
- Compromise energy effectiveness, resulting in greater heating bills.
- Allow drafts into the home, reducing comfort.
- Interfere with the property's visual appeal.
- Perhaps reduce the residential or commercial property's worth if left unattended.

What to Expect During the Replacement Process
To guarantee a smooth replacement procedure, homeowners should be gotten ready for the following steps:
- Initial Consultation: A specialist examines the existing windows and discusses alternatives with the homeowner.
- Measurements: Accurate measurements are taken to ensure a perfect suitable for the new windows.
- Product Selection: Homeowners pick from numerous products, designs, and surfaces.
- Removal: The old windows are thoroughly removed without causing any damage to the surrounding areas.
- Setup: Specialists set up the brand-new windows, guaranteeing they are properly sealed and lined up.
- Completing Touches: This may consist of painting, staining, or including ornamental features.
- Last Inspection: The expert guarantees everything functions properly and satisfies quality requirements.
FAQs about Sash Window Replacement
1. How long does the sash window replacement take?
The duration of the replacement process depends upon a number of factors, consisting of the number of windows and the complexity of the setup. Generally, it can take anywhere from a day to a week.
2. Can I replace sash windows myself?
While it's possible for a skilled DIY enthusiast to replace sash windows, hiring specialists is advisable. They have the know-how and tools to ensure a correct fit and function.
3. How do I choose the right sash window replacement professional?
When choosing a specialist, consider their experience, reviews, and previous work. It's also beneficial to request quotes from numerous companies to compare.
4. Exist energy performance advantages to brand-new sash windows?
Yes, modern-day sash windows can be fitted with energy-efficient features such as double-glazing, which helps to decrease heat loss and lower energy expenses.
5. Will I need to obtain planning approval for sash window replacement?
In a lot of cases, you will not need planning consent for replacement windows unless you live in a listed structure or designated preservation area. Always check local regulations initially.
